Which long-term health effects is highly associated with a diagnosis of anorexia nervosa

Is there choices or a requirement of how many you need? but long term affects of anorexia nervosa is bone weakening, anemia, seizures, thyroid problems, lack of vitamins and minerals, low potassium levels, and the list goes on..

The most common ways to treat cancer include
Alex Ar [27]

radiation therapy, chemotherapy, immunotherapy, targeted therapy, or hormone therapy.
